## Runbook — Monthly Partition Rotation (Grainfall DB)

On the first of each month, the rotation job creates next month's partition and detaches the one from thirteen months ago. If the job stalls, check that `GRAINFALL_PARTITION_SCHEME=monthly` is set in the worker env file. The rotation worker also needs its admin credential on the following line:

vault entry, yahif-yajep: COURIER_KEY29=b802bdf8034096b65a51c6ba5abe2

## Changelog — Brindlesearch 3.2

Renamed `NIGHTLY_REINDEX_CRON` to `SEARCH_REINDEX_SCHEDULE`. Plugin authors reading the old key will get a deprecation warning until 3.4, after which it is removed. Semantics are unchanged: standard cron syntax, evaluated in the node's local timezone. Plugins that trigger reindexes remotely must also present the reindex service credential, which the environment file sets on the line immediately below.

secret setting of hawep-yahig: LEDGER_TOKEN29=41b5d6315371c92885eaeb077fb63

MEMO — Sales Leads Only

Effective next quarter, the commission scheme changes: base rate drops to 4%, with a 7% accelerator above quota on Vantrell Suite deals. Renewals now count at half weight. Draw arrangements end for tenured reps. Questions go to Priya before Friday's call. The rationale ties to broader plans, summarized confidentially below.

board note of bawep-tajef: Queniusek Systems plans to raise the Quenvan list price by 53.1 percent in March. The pricing group signed off on a budget of $176.4 million for Project Drueth. The renewal with Casionix Partners closes at $142.5 million a year, 8.3 percent below the last contract. Project Fraax slips by six weeks because of the tooling delay.

// Fixture: autocomplete widget for the Mapletide address picker.
// Seeds six suggestions covering partial street, city-only, and
// empty-result cases. Mock server echoes query latency of 80ms.
// Do not edit suggestion order; snapshot tests depend on it.
// The mock upstream expects the bearer token below on every call.

bearer token for tawig-bahif: eyJhbGciOiJIUzI1NiIsInR5cCI6IkpXVCJ9.eyJzdWIiOiIo-yiO33jvEIn0.T9qLInSAqhTN